Definitions
- adjective. Of or pertaining to a woman, or to women; characteristic of a woman; womanish; womanly.
- adjective. Having the qualities of a woman; becoming or appropriate to the female sex; as, in a good sense, modest, graceful, affectionate, confiding; or, in a bad sense, weak, nerveless, timid, pleasure-loving, effeminate.
- noun. A woman.
- noun. Any one of those words which are the appellations of females, or which have the terminations usually found in such words; as, actress, songstress, abbess, executrix.
- noun. a gender that refers chiefly (but not exclusively) to females or to objects classified as female
- adjective. associated with women and not with men
"feminine intuition"
- adjective. befitting or characteristic of a woman especially a mature woman
"womanly virtues of gentleness and compassion"
- adjective. of grammatical gender
- adjective. (music or poetry) ending on an unaccented beat or syllable
"a feminine ending"
